As the designer behind one of the most iconic dresses in history, you could say David Emanuel knows a thing or two about wedding dresses.
Speaking in Australia, the Welsh designer of Princess Diana's wedding dress revealed a few tips about how modern-day brides can get the perfect gown.
The esteemed designer's number one piece of advice? Keep an open mind.

'Are you flamboyant, fun, reserved, classical, low key? Be open to it,' the 64-year-old designer told Mamamia.
'Listen [to those who know]. And only try on gowns within your budget.'
Mr Emanuel was handpicked by Princess Diana to design her wedding dress in 1981, after he graced the pages of Vogue magazine.
While he said that these days women often come with an 'entourage' of between six and eight people when they try on wedding dresses, Mr Emanuel said Diana came with one person - her mother.
'Enough. She didn't need the world there. Bring someone with you that you trust and trust their taste.'
The designer added that if you bring your best friend, they will most likely only like the things that would suit them - they won't necessarily think of the bride.

Mr Emanuel's other tips for wedding dress shopping include buying in a physical shop rather than online, and shopping for your gown some 12 months before your wedding.
'Start with going through your closet and seeing what styles you've got that you like,' he said.
'Look at various bridal magazines, go online. Look at your friends' wedding gowns when you go to their weddings.'
The designer also warned against the dangers of over-shopping. Rather than trying on 40 gowns and feeling confused, he said it's best to go with your instinct.

Mr Emanuel also spoke about Prince Harry's current girlfriend, Meghan Markle, and how he would style her were she to wed the young British prince:
'I'd make her look really polished and elegant, but I'm not saying a silhouette either,' he said.
'She is an actress so she'll be very aware of her look because she can see herself on the screen, she'll have learned what looks good...'
